Mother’s Touches for Greeting Cards and Personalized Invitations
When designing greeting cards, especially for Mother’s Day or birthdays, Mother’s Touches is a game-changer. It has that gentle, handwritten quality that feels like a handwritten note from a loved one. I recently created a series of thank-you cards for a local boutique, and the customers loved how the font made the messages feel more heartfelt and personal.
For invitations, I’ve found that Mother’s Touches works best when paired with a clean sans serif font for the event details. The contrast between the elegant script and the modern typeface creates a balanced look that’s both stylish and approachable. It’s perfect for wedding stationery, baby shower invites, or any event where you want to convey warmth and elegance.

Mother’s Touches for Planner Pages and Creative Stationery
Planner pages and creative stationery are another area where Mother’s Touches shines. I’ve designed a few planner templates that feature the font in a minimalist layout, allowing the text to stand out without overwhelming the page. The font’s flowing lines add a sense of movement and grace, making it ideal for journaling and bullet points.
When pairing Mother’s Touches with other fonts, I often choose a clean sans serif or simple serif font to balance the design. This combination ensures that the text remains readable while still maintaining the charm of the script. It’s also important to check the included styles, ligatures, and weights before selling any templates or printables, as these features can enhance the overall design experience.
